im am thinking of buying some new rims and they have a polished lip. I was under the impression that the lower the offset (say +32) will the lip be bigger then on a (say +45) offset. i would post this in the apperance forum but there are stuiped people over there
There's more to it technically than that, but yes, in a general sense, the lip does relate to the offset so the lower the offset, the fatter the lip. That's why on the some of the RWD cars that run +1 and +3 offsets, they have huge lip. +32 on an FF Honda is pretty crazy though, might run into some clearance and driveability problems depending on the size of the wheel. I knew a guy who ran +27 old school 15" SSR Formula Mesh on his CRX without much problems and another guy who ran 16" Gab Sports in a +32 offset on his Integra without issues.
